Monologue for iOS

Monologue is genuinely useful for people whose ideas outpace their typing. The jump from voice โ†’ polished output (not raw transcript) is what separates it. Founders writing solo are the sweet spot โ€” one voice note, one ready-to-send email.

Straion

If you're a serious vibe coder with multiple projects or a team using AI coding tools, Straion solves a real pain: keeping your AI agent rules consistent, versioned, and shareable. Early but promising.

Pros & Cons

Monologue for iOS

Pros

  • +Captures ideas in the moment โ€” voice is faster than typing for most people
  • +Output is actually polished โ€” not raw transcription dump
  • +Strong mobile UX for on-the-go use

Cons

  • -Voice-to-text quality depends on ambient noise and accent
  • -Less control over exact phrasing โ€” AI rewrites, not transcribes
  • -iOS only โ€” no Android or desktop

Straion

Pros

  • +Solves the scattered .cursorrules problem
  • +Works across multiple AI coding tools
  • +Shareable rule templates accelerate setup
  • +Version control for AI behavior โ€” underrated feature

Cons

  • -Early stage โ€” fewer integrations than mature tools
  • -Value depends on how heavily you rely on AI coding agents
  • -Small community still forming
